    Where to start? I have a number or law firms that refer to me as their “legal research ” dept on arbitration issues. Why? Because they are too cheap to maintain a decent research/library staff. Too busy booking those billable hours. OK. Here in Texas, many law firms are requiring clients to sign a binding arbitration agreement as a requirement for representation. Absolutely enforceable. AND, if they designate the FAA as controlling, screw the Tx Gen Arbitration Act. AND, if the FAA controls, the terms of the agreement must be enforced AS WRITTEN. That means a limitation on damages is enforceable. So says the US Supreme Court. I’m not an attorney, but I can read and have more than 3 brain cells. Been following the development of arbitration since 1994. It IS settled law.
